Basically, you need to respond to any 276 query.
The response may be "Not Found".  You should, however, respond with the status of any claim that is in your adjudication system, independant of the date processed, or what format it was received in.
 
On Page 11 of the IG, some parameters on length of availability are laid out --
For realtime access, claims accepted into the adjudication system in the last 90 days are to be reported on; for batch access, and claim that has not been purged from the adjudication system is to be reported on.  The combination of the two modes of access implies that the claim status must be available in the adjudication system for a minimum of 90 days from the time it was accepted into the adjudication system.
 
If complient claims are in a separate adjudication system from the legacy claims, it has been argued that the legacy claims could be classified as "purged", and thus not available for 276 query.  I think that this is a poor approach.  A better one would be to load into the new system a record indicating that a claim exists (subscriber / patient / date / provider info, no service info or other status), and to return a status of "No further status is available electronically"
